She told him he was intelligent - and he believed her.What he didn’t know was that his entire life had been carefully controlled.This powerful Australian true story exposes the devastating reality of coercive psychological control hidden behind family love.Behind closed doors, Devin was praised yet denied autonomy. Protected, yet deliberately kept dependent. He was encouraged to believe he was intelligent while never being taught how to read, write, or function independently - not to empower him, but in ways that kept him unaware of the deeper deception shaping his life. The illusion of capability concealed a system designed to maintain control, quietly limiting his ability to understand what was happening to him.The same patterns shaped his father’s life, where independence was gradually undermined and personal agency steadily eroded. As influence tightened around them, decisions were steered, outcomes manipulated, and both men became increasingly vulnerable to forces they could neither fully see nor effectively resist.As the truth began to surface, loyalty collided with reality. Silence was rewarded. Speaking carried consequences. Even when evidence existed, the system defended itself.The Devil in Disguise is not an act of revenge or accusation. It is a documented true account revealing how coercive control can operate within families - quiet, deniable, and deeply devastating.Perfect for readers interested in:• True stories of psychological abuse• Coercive control within families• Family manipulation and dependency• Trauma, survival, and emotional resilience• Real-life psychological memoirs
